Talent.com
Senior Software Engineer
Senior Software EngineerUrban Connect AG • Zürich, Zurich, Switzerland
Les candidatures ne sont plus acceptées
Senior Software Engineer

Senior Software Engineer

Urban Connect AG • Zürich, Zurich, Switzerland
Il y a plus de 30 jours
Type de contrat
  • Quick Apply
Description de poste

Urban Connect is a well-funded Swiss tech company based in Zürich. We are focused

on developing solutions for corporate mobility. Among our clients are Google,

Roche, IKEA, Hitachi, SWISS Airlines, ETH, Lindt and Sprüngli, Hilti and Avaloq. With our mobility solutions, we contribute to more sustainable and efficient corporate transportation across Switzerland and beyond.

Tasks

We are looking for a senior software developer to reinforce our backend team

on-site in Zürich. This job requires a lot of experience in mobility, as well as financial

services and accounting. We need someone capable of driving forward our backend

systems from day one, trained to take full ownership of the processes and forged for

hard work under considerable pressure and ever looming deadlines.

Candidates must be capable of designing and building complex yet maintainable systems, and of implementing them efficiently within demanding timeframes. They should possess solid experience in handling financial processes, including transactions, liabilities, bank cards, company invoices, payments, and refunds. In addition, we require proven expertise and a deep understanding of ground transportation and mobility, such as vehicle sharing, delivery, cargo, or taxi services.

Requirements

1. At least 10 years of experience in writing production code in Ruby using

Ruby-on-Rails. Most of our code is written in Ruby using the Ruby-on-Rails

framework. Our core service is implemented in the form of a Rails based

HTTP API with background jobs processed by Sidekiq, fully covered with tests

in RSpec and deployed as a Docker container using Nomad. Our clients are our

own mobile apps for iOS, Android and our web applications built using React.

2. Experience in writing high load production code in Go. We have

performance critical parts of our systems built using Go, so you must

demonstrate considerable experience in writing production code using this

programming language.

3. Experience in writing high load production code in Python. Our data

processing and machine learning pipeline is implemented using Python, so

proficient knowledge of this language is a requirement, as well as a proven

track record of using it for building advanced systems.

4. Master's degree or its equivalent in information technology or computer

science. We value deep knowledge of algorithms, data structures, databases,

patterns of building enterprise systems and security considerations related to

that.

5. Strong communication skills in English are essential, as our team brings together professionals from across the globe, representing at least seven different native languages. English serves as our shared language for collaboration. Experience in international, English-speaking teams is highly desirable and will be considered a significant advantage.

6. Previous experience in building mobility related projects. We develop and

support full scale booking systems for e-bikes, e-cars, public transport and

parking. So, proven experience in the mobility industry is necessary for this

position.

7. Previous experience in financial services or banking is required. Our work involves issuing virtual bank cards, managing budget allocations, and handling financial transactions for our clients, ensuring accurate reconciliation at the end of each month, quarter, and year. Proven expertise in financial services, in addition to core mobility competencies, is therefore essential for this position.

Additional qualifications we highly value :

1. Good understanding of infrastructure and desire to learn more. We have

limited resources, so we don’t have a separate SRE or DevOps team and we do

not separate development of the system from operating it. So, knowledge of

how to configure CI / CD, what Dockerfile looks like, how containers are

orchestrated and how reverse proxy terminates TLS connection should be in

your toolbox.

2. Good understanding of databases. You should know how to use classic SQL

databases (in our case that is PostgreSQL), as well as some other noSQL tools

(such as Redis, S3 and ElasticSearch) for data storage and processing.

3. As our technology team has traditionally included Russian-speaking developers, proficiency in Russian would be highly beneficial. It would help to bridge language gaps and support effective, seamless collaboration across the team.

Benefits

A culture that values people over processes, seeks to avoid ego-driven

melodramas, and offers a lot of potential to develop in areas of passion and

interest.

  • Access to a company fleet of e-bikes, bikes, e-scooters and shared e-cars.
  • Dynamic start-up team spirit.
  • The opportunity to grow a company internationally from a fantastic client base.
  • Competitive start-up compensation package.
  • Attractive office in the heart of Zurich.

Fun work environment that takes very seriously the balancing of performance

with personal well-being.

  • Joint team activities that strengthen communication and create a positive working environment
  • If you are interested in this position, please submit your application (CV and cover letter) directly via Join.

    In your cover letter, we kindly ask you to outline your professional background and explain why you consider yourself a strong fit for this role. Please address the requirements listed above by highlighting relevant experience and competencies. We also encourage you to share information about your career path, current professional situation, and future aspirations.

    Your application will be reviewed by our team, after which we will be pleased to invite selected candidates for an interview.

    Urban Connect is a multi-modal carbon-neutral mobility platform for corporates that offers an ecosystem of low-emission, shared vehicles. The platform provides companies with premium vehicles such as e-scooters, e-bikes, e-cargo bikes, e-cars, and an access to the public transport – with everything bookable via one app. In addition, the platform offers a climate cockpit where fleets’ residual emissions are tracked and offset. It also allows simple integration of client’s existing vehicle fleets to optimize the fleet composition, usage, and neutralize emissions. In this context, the platform helps companies build an optimized, carbon-neutral, cost-effective mobility mix for their employees.

    Créer une alerte emploi pour cette recherche

    Senior Software Engineer • Zürich, Zurich, Switzerland

    Offres similaires
    Senior System Engineer

    Senior System Engineer

    UMB AG, Zweigniederlassung Volketswil • Zug, CH
    Wir sind ein grossartiges Team und werden immer wieder von Great Place to Work als beste Arbeitgeberin ausgezeichnet.Dir fehlt Wertschätzung? Wir sind bekannt für unsere positive Feedback-Kultur.Du...Voir plus
    Dernière mise à jour : il y a 13 jours • Offre sponsorisée
    (Senior) DevOps Engineer (m / w / d)

    (Senior) DevOps Engineer (m / w / d)

    Karl Storz SE & Co. KG • Schaffhausen, CH
    Tätigkeitsbereich : Forschung & Entwicklung.Standort : Schaffhausen, SH, CH, 8200.Verwaltung unserer DevOps-Infrastruktur : . Verantworten Sie die Verwaltung und Optimierung unserer DevOps-Infrastruktur...Voir plus
    Dernière mise à jour : il y a 6 jours • Offre sponsorisée
    Software Engineer Smart Machine / Iot / Digitalisierung

    Software Engineer Smart Machine / Iot / Digitalisierung

    Syntegon Packaging Systems AG • Beringen SH, CH
    Mit reibungslosen Prozessen, innovativen Technologien und nachhaltigen Lösungen helfen wir unseren Kunden, ihre Ziele zu erreichen. Wir sorgen zum Beispiel dafür, dass Impfstoffe sicher abgefüllt we...Voir plus
    Dernière mise à jour : il y a 15 jours • Offre sponsorisée
    Fullstack Software Engineer 80-100% (Senior)

    Fullstack Software Engineer 80-100% (Senior)

    healthinal • Rapperswil, Canton Zug, Switzerland
    Salary : CHF 90’000 - 120’000 per year.Du verfügst über ein abgeschlossenes Informatikstudium an FH-, Uni- oder ETH.Du verfügst über mindestens 5 Jahre Erfahrung in der Fullstack (Web-) Entwicklung ...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    (Senior) Software Engineer in a fast-growing AI Startup

    (Senior) Software Engineer in a fast-growing AI Startup

    Lightly AG • Zürich, Zurich, Switzerland
    Télétravail
    Quick Apply
    At the ETH spin-off Lightly, we build software solutions to help companies improve their deep learning models.The available data for deep learning grows faster than human tagging and available comp...Voir plus
    Dernière mise à jour : il y a plus de 30 jours
    Senior Devops Engineer

    Senior Devops Engineer

    Livingdocs AG • Zürich, CH
    Help us shape the future of media technology.You understand that great tech products are supported by strong DevOps practices that complement other teams’ processes while keeping technical debts lo...Voir plus
    Dernière mise à jour : il y a 8 jours • Offre sponsorisée
    Senior Fullstack Software Engineer (100% Remote)

    Senior Fullstack Software Engineer (100% Remote)

    Tether Operations Limited • Zürich, ZH, CH
    Télétravail
    Join Tether and Shape the Future of Digital Finance.At Tether, we’re not just building products, we’re pioneering a global financial revolution. Our cutting-edge solutions empower businesses—from ex...Voir plus
    Dernière mise à jour : il y a 22 jours
    Senior System Engineer

    Senior System Engineer

    Nordwand Group • Zürich, CH
    Unser Kunde ist ein renommiertes Unternehmen in Zürich und sucht eine selbstständige sowie technisch versierte Person zur Verstärkung des IT-Teams. Sie sind für die Planung und die Konzeption von ko...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Senior Software Engineer

    Senior Software Engineer

    Coopers Group AG • Zürich, Zurich, Switzerland
    Quick Apply
    Für ein dreijähriges Projekt in einem äusserst sensitiven Umfeld bei unserem Kunden aus der Schweizer Bundesverwaltung in Bern, suchen wir eine : n erfahrene : n Senior Software Entwickler : in.Design un...Voir plus
    Dernière mise à jour : il y a 16 jours
    Senior DevOps Engineer (a) •

    Senior DevOps Engineer (a) •

    Ringier AG • Zürich, CH
    Join our dynamic and diverse team as a Senior DevOps Engineer and contribute to shaping the architecture of our applications. We seek a motivated and committed engineer to join our expanding team.Sp...Voir plus
    Dernière mise à jour : il y a 29 jours • Offre sponsorisée
    Senior Software Engineer - Distributed Systems

    Senior Software Engineer - Distributed Systems

    Decentriq • Zürich, Zurich, Switzerland
    Quick Apply
    Decentriq is the rising leader in data-clean-room technology.With Decentriq, advertisers, retailers, and publishers securely collaborate on 1st-party data for optimal audience targeting and campaig...Voir plus
    Dernière mise à jour : il y a plus de 30 jours
    Software Engineer - Backend Lead (Python / C#)

    Software Engineer - Backend Lead (Python / C#)

    Manukai • Zürich, Zurich, Switzerland
    Quick Apply
    Japanese methodology of continuous improvement, that translates to “change for better.We are a spin-off from ETH Zürich, aiming to bridge the gap between metal part design and machining.Our technol...Voir plus
    Dernière mise à jour : il y a 19 jours
    Senior Software Engineer 100%

    Senior Software Engineer 100%

    Ipex AG • Wallisellen, CH
    Entwicklung und Wartung von Softwarelösungen unter Verwendung von Java und weiteren neuesten Technologien.Zusammenarbeit mit dem Team zur Implementierung neuer Features und zur Verbesserung bestehe...Voir plus
    Dernière mise à jour : il y a 3 jours • Offre sponsorisée
    Senior Software Engineer / Architect

    Senior Software Engineer / Architect

    GlobalEngineer GmbH • Zürich, Zurich, Switzerland
    Quick Apply
    GlobalEngineer is an innovative company operating in various engineering sectors.In mechanical and plant engineering — for example, in the energy industry — we are engaged in the development and im...Voir plus
    Dernière mise à jour : il y a plus de 30 jours
    Senior Software Engineer (m / f) 60 - 100 %

    Senior Software Engineer (m / f) 60 - 100 %

    triarc-laboratories • Zürich, Canton Zurich, Switzerland
    Salary : CHF 80’000 - 105’000 per year.Leidenschaft für die Software Entwicklung.Hochschulabschluss in Informatik (ETH / Universität / FH / vergleichbarer Leistungsnachweis). Hohe Methodenkompetenz und log...Voir plus
    Dernière mise à jour : il y a 17 jours
    Senior Backend Engineer (Golang)

    Senior Backend Engineer (Golang)

    Futurae • Zürich, ZH, CH
    Télétravail
    Quick Apply
    We are looking for a Senior Backend Engineer at Futurae that will play a crucial role in maintaining and developing our cutting-edge cloud-based multi-factor authentication and fraud prevention sof...Voir plus
    Dernière mise à jour : il y a 9 heures • Nouvelle offre
    Senior System Engineer

    Senior System Engineer

    PIUS Consulting • Cham, Canton of Zug, Switzerland
    Quick Apply
    Unser Mandant ist seit über 15 Jahren erfolgreich im Markt als Softwareanbieter für Businesslösungen unterwegs.Aufgrund der kontinuierlichen Wachstumsstrategie, suchen wir für das Team einen Senior...Voir plus
    Dernière mise à jour : il y a plus de 30 jours
    Software Engineer (Deutschschweiz)

    Software Engineer (Deutschschweiz)

    Arctive AG • Zug, Canton Zug, Switzerland
    Salary : CHF 85’000 - 105’000 per year.Wir passen zusammen, wenn Du Folgendes mitbringst : .Mehrjährige Erfahrung bei der Umsetzung und Einführung von IT-Lösungen. Lust auf Teamarbeit und Cloud-Technol...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ée